Earnings Report for December 1, 2025: CRDO, MDB, VSTS, SLP Released After Market Hours
Credo Technology Group Holding Ltd (CRDO): Expected to report earnings with a forecasted EPS of $0.31, reflecting a 1133.33% increase year-over-year, and has consistently beaten expectations in the past year.
MongoDB, Inc. (MDB): Anticipated to report earnings with a forecasted EPS of -$0.53, indicating a 35.90% decrease compared to the previous year, yet has also beaten expectations consistently.
Vestis Corporation (VSTS): Set to report earnings with a forecasted EPS of $0.03, showing a 72.73% decrease year-over-year, but is projected to have higher earnings growth than its industry competitors.
Simulations Plus, Inc. (SLP): Expected to report earnings with a forecasted EPS of $0.10, representing a 66.67% increase year-over-year, although it missed the consensus in the previous quarter.

- Impressive Earnings: Datadog reported quarterly revenue exceeding $1 billion for the first time, leading to a 31% surge in its stock price, which reflects the company's strong performance in the artificial intelligence sector and a restoration of investor confidence.
- Customer Expansion: CEO Olivier Pomel revealed that Datadog secured partnerships with two major hyperscaler customers focused on training in their superintelligence labs, further solidifying its leadership in the cloud infrastructure market.
- Industry Impact: Datadog's robust performance not only boosted its own stock but also propelled shares of Snowflake and MongoDB up by 10% each, indicating widespread market confidence in AI-related companies.
- Positive Twilio Performance: Twilio showcased new platform capabilities that enhance AI agents' communication efficiency during its investor day, resulting in a 50% stock price increase over the past month, reflecting market favor for companies effectively leveraging AI solutions.
